Most new owners have a typical 4-5 series of questions that follow a pattern and I have some suggestions to get you going even quicker on the forum.

To make both your new experience and overall experience better for all, I would recommend a few helpful hints:

1) Post a pic of your new ride-or several! If you need help, PM me I'll be glad to help you. What's a PM? :) You're in trouble! LOL Private Message You can also set up your signature and avatar too, which is always fun! Advanced users can later do a "Poll" to ask opinions of members on new wheels or whatever to get a group opinion.

2) Let us know why you bought your SC, what you used to drive and plans for modifications or any current issues you may have. These cars are sophisticated and have many moving parts! We are here to help...BUT BEFORE YOU DO THAT---SEE BELOW:

3) Please use the search function. While you are signed in, go to "Search" then "Advanced Search" and type in your keyword and to the bottom right select the SC430 forum to specifically target this forum. We have discussed thousands of issues over the course of nearly ten years when the first SC430 rolled off the line in August of 2001. Ironically, sometimes we beat topics to death over and over again. Most likely if you are thinking it as a new SC430 owner, we have discussed it! There are a few threads at the top called "Sticky" that have some good general information as well.

Most common "newbie" questions that can easily be found in search are...

Just type in these key words in search to help find your answers:

2006 SC430 Pebble Beach
 
3 Attachment(s)
Hi everyone.
been reading on here & other sites about this and other convertibles.
was comparing mercedes, lexus, bmw, audi, infinity......
after owning mercedes and bmw over the last 10 years.
in the end, reliability & cost of ownership for a fun car got me to this point.
last week, I pulled the trigger and pick up a 2006 SC430 Pebble Beach with 118K miles.
local 1-owner, very clean car inside & out, everything works!
I am checking on servuce history to see if the 90-100K services was completed (belts, water pump, etc...)

1. Exterior color - Tiger-eye Brown (very good condition - still)
2. Interior color - Tan ( a bit weathered but still in good condition)
3. Audio options (Mark Levinson) - MK, 2 speakers are scratchy and will need to be replaced
4. minor problems:
a) speakers - will be replaced
b) driver side door handle - the key cover part is missing
- was thinking of buying knock-off on ebay and then have airbrushed/pained+clearcoat
- dealer rep actually offer to reimburse for Lexus OEM replacement
c) a couple of places the body cover is no longer tightly attached - assumed with 10 yrs, gotten lossened over the time.
- will need to look into how to get it to "stick" back tightly again
5. Any modifications: would like to upgrade
a) radio/GPS: would love to have the new receiver integrated with iPhone + into the GPS screen like the one I saw on YouTube seen here=>
b) wheels/tires: the mercedes dealer actually installed brand new Pilot A/S tires all around.
- looking at 19" GS-350F version - like the ones I saw on here
c) headlights & fog lights - maybe LEDs
d) antenna: hmmmm - looking for the stubby or any newer version that would work....
6. Just a fun car to alternate from the daily driver; especially with the nice Houston weather
7. Houston, Texas (Missouri City)
8. a couple of quick pix - will get better ones once the sun comes back out

will read thru in the past posting to edcuate myself + consider all your advices
thank you everyone for all the info!!
